It is suggested that you have each foot measured individually if you aren’t quite sure what your correct shoe size is. Many people have one foot that’s a bit larger or longer than the other. Try to buy some shoes that are going to fit on your foot that’s longer or wider so you can be comfortable.
Do not purchase a pair of shoes before putting both shoes on and walking around the store for a while. The fit may be inaccurate if you do not give them a try. Try on different sizes to find the best fit.
Check your arch type prior to buying athletic shoes. They will not fit on every arch. One way to do this is to moisten your feet then place your feet on a sheet of plain paper. The wet parts can tell you what type of arch you have. If you can see the entire footprint, your have a flat arch. A high arch means that you won’t see the middle of the print. Knowing this may help you select shoes that fit more comfortably.
